A Haunting and Unforgettable Story of Love, Loss, and Redemption
Fiona Benson's Blood Orange is a stunning and unforgettable novel about love, loss, and the power of redemption. The novel tells the story of Cara and her journey through the depths of grief after the sudden death of her beloved husband, Michael.
As Cara struggles to come to terms with her loss, she finds solace in the memories of their life together and the small moments that made their love so special. But as she delves deeper into her memories, Cara also uncovers dark secrets that threaten to destroy everything she thought she knew about Michael.
